Parcourir la source

이중 쿼리 기반으로 변경

잉여개발기 il y a 2 ans
Parent
commit
5d235aa3d3
2 fichiers modifiés avec 2 ajouts et 2 suppressions
  1. BIN
      route_go/bin/main.amd64.exe
  2. 2 2
      route_go/route/api_list_old_page.go

BIN
route_go/bin/main.amd64.exe


+ 2 - 2
route_go/route/api_list_old_page.go

@@ -36,9 +36,9 @@ func Api_list_old_page(call_arg []string) {
 	var stmt *sql.Stmt
 	var stmt *sql.Stmt
 
 
 	if other_set["set_type"] == "old" {
 	if other_set["set_type"] == "old" {
-		stmt, err = db.Prepare(tool.DB_change(db_set, "select doc_name, set_data from data_set where set_name = 'last_edit' and doc_rev = '' order by set_data asc limit ?, 50"))
+		stmt, err = db.Prepare(tool.DB_change(db_set, "select doc_name, set_data from data_set where set_name = 'last_edit' and doc_rev = '' and (doc_name) in (select doc_name from data_set where set_name = 'doc_type' and set_data = '') order by set_data asc limit ?, 50"))
 	} else {
 	} else {
-		stmt, err = db.Prepare(tool.DB_change(db_set, "select doc_name, set_data from data_set where set_name = 'last_edit' and doc_rev = '' order by set_data desc limit ?, 50"))
+		stmt, err = db.Prepare(tool.DB_change(db_set, "select doc_name, set_data from data_set where set_name = 'last_edit' and doc_rev = '' and (doc_name) in (select doc_name from data_set where set_name = 'doc_type' and set_data = '') order by set_data desc limit ?, 50"))
 	}
 	}
 
 
 	if err != nil {
 	if err != nil {